Unicorn Designs is my personal handmade furniture brand - colorful, rounded forms that bring joy into functional objects. Designing the brand and e-commerce presence was both a creative outlet and a real exercise in building a cohesive product identity from scratch.

The challenge was translating the tactile, joyful quality of handmade objects into a digital experience โ€” ensuring the website felt as playful and distinctive as the products themselves, without sacrificing usability or e-commerce conversion.

Handmade furniture brands often struggle to translate physical craft into digital presence โ€” either looking too polished (losing the handmade feel) or too rough (losing buyer confidence). The brand needed to feel joyful, tactile, and trustworthy simultaneously.

  • No existing brand identity โ€” needed to be created from zero
  • Products have a distinctive aesthetic that generic templates can't represent
  • E-commerce requires trust signals that handmade brands sometimes lack
  • Color and form are the brand's core personality โ€” they needed to lead the design

The Unicorn Designs brand identity leads with color โ€” bold, playful palettes that reflect the furniture's personality โ€” paired with clean, rounded typography and a layout system designed to let the products breathe and speak for themselves.

Design principles

Color as personality

The brand palette is bold and distinctive โ€” not safe or minimal. Colors are drawn directly from the furniture pieces, creating cohesion between product and identity.

Rounded forms everywhere

Typography, buttons, cards, and layout elements all mirror the rounded language of the furniture โ€” creating visual coherence between the brand system and the products themselves.

Clean e-commerce UX

Beneath the playful aesthetic, the e-commerce structure is clear and frictionless โ€” product pages, pricing, and contact paths follow established usability patterns so the joy never gets in the way of the purchase.
